American emergency 1. Emergency is the most important thing for travelers, because they can go directly without making an appointment.

2. But the emergency room in America is divided into emergency room (er) and emergency care, which must be made clear!

What is ER? When do I go to the emergency room?

Emergency room (ER) is actually translated as first aid.

All life-threatening situations should go to the emergency room, such as gunshot wounds, coma, massive bleeding, heart disease and so on.

What is emergency care and when to go to emergency care?

Emergency care is aimed at situations that are not urgent but need immediate help. It is similar to the emergency in China, but it is a community clinic in scale.

Emergency care can deal with fever, vomiting, diarrhea, minor trauma (which can be regarded as skin-level injury, emergency

Care can sew! ), minor fracture (fingers and toes are injured, and X-ray examination can also be carried out in emergency)

What is the core difference between er and UrgentCare?

ER is used to cure diseases and save lives! Well-equipped, doctors in all disciplines can perform surgery ... even if the price is expensive, it is appropriate to call it sky-high price! ! !

UrgentCare is suitable for the' emergency' situation of most ordinary people. Diarrhea medicine doesn't work, and the cost is cheaper than er! ! !

The details are different:

#ER is a 24-hour, UrgentCare sub-region, there are 24 hours, and there are also people who get off work on 10.

#ER Average cost1000-2,000 USD, emergency care 50- 150 USD.

The average waiting time of #ER is 4 hours (according to the patient's danger), and the average waiting time of emergency care is 30 minutes.

# After arriving in the United States, you can find the location of ER/UrgentCare nearby by searching on googlemap.
